Understanding Foam Density and Its Role in Seat Cushions

Before discussing the ideal thickness, it’s essential to understand the role of foam density in seat cushions. Foam density is measured in pounds per cubic foot (pcf) and indicates how much a cubic foot of foam weighs. Density is crucial because it affects the foam’s ability to provide support and its durability. High-density foam is generally more supportive and longer-lasting than low-density foam, but it can also be firmer and less comfortable for some users. The choice of foam density depends on the intended use of the seat and the preferences of the users.

Guidelines for Selecting the Right Foam Thickness

While there’s no one-size-fits-all answer to the ideal foam thickness for seat cushions, there are general guidelines that can help in making an informed decision.

Standard Thickness Ranges

For most applications, foam thickness for seat cushions ranges from about 1 inch to 4 inches.
Thin foam (1-2 inches) is often used in applications where a firm seat is desired or in situations where the seat is not used for extended periods.
Medium-thickness foam (2-3 inches) is a common choice for many residential and commercial applications, offering a balance between support and comfort.
Thicker foam (3-4 inches) is ideal for heavy-duty applications or for users who prefer a softer, more cushioned seat.

Specialized Applications

In certain cases, such as in medical or therapeutic seating, the foam thickness may need to be adjusted based on specific requirements. For example, seats designed for individuals with mobility issues might require custom foam thickness to ensure proper support and comfort.

How does foam density affect seat cushion comfort?

Foam density plays a significant role in determining the comfort and support of a seat cushion. High-density foams are more supportive and durable than low-density foams, but they can also be firmer and less comfortable. Low-density foams, on the other hand, are softer and more comfortable, but they may not provide enough support and can break down more quickly. The ideal foam density for seat cushion comfort will depend on the intended use and personal preference, but a good starting point is a medium-density foam with a density of around 1.5-2.5 pounds per cubic foot.

In addition to affecting comfort and support, foam density also affects the durability and longevity of the seat cushion. High-density foams are more resistant to compression and degradation, and can withstand heavy use and wear and tear. Low-density foams, on the other hand, may require more frequent replacement and maintenance. When selecting a foam for a seat cushion, it’s essential to consider the trade-offs between comfort, support, and durability, and choose a foam that meets the user’s needs and preferences. By selecting the right foam density, users can ensure optimal comfort and support, and extend the lifespan of their seat cushion.

Can I use a single layer of foam for my seat cushion, or do I need multiple layers?

Using a single layer of foam for a seat cushion can be sufficient, but it may not provide the optimal comfort and support. A single layer of foam can be prone to compression and degradation, especially if it’s a low-density foam. Additionally, a single layer of foam may not provide enough support and pressure relief, particularly for users who are heavier or have mobility issues. In contrast, using multiple layers of foam can provide a more customized and supportive seat cushion, with each layer serving a specific purpose.

For example, a seat cushion with multiple layers of foam might include a thick, high-density layer for support and a thinner, lower-density layer for comfort and pressure relief. This combination can provide optimal support and comfort, and can help to reduce fatigue and discomfort. When using multiple layers of foam, it’s essential to consider the thickness and density of each layer, as well as the overall thickness and density of the seat cushion. By using multiple layers of foam, users can create a customized seat cushion that meets their specific needs and preferences, and provides optimal comfort and support.
